5 Home Updates to Consider Before Selling Your Home

Selling your home can be an exciting time, but it can also be stressful. One of the most important things you can do to make the process go smoothly is to make sure your home is in the best possible condition before listing it. Here are some updates you can make to your home that can help increase its value and appeal to potential buyers.

  1. Fresh paint:

    One of the most cost-effective updates you can make is a fresh coat of paint. This can help make your home look cleaner, brighter and more modern. Neutral colors are a great option, as they appeal to a wider range of buyers.

  2. Updated lighting:

    Lighting is an important aspect of any home, and it can make a big difference in how a room looks and feels. Consider updating light fixtures, adding lamps or even skylights to create a more inviting atmosphere.

  3. Kitchen and bathroom updates:

    These are two of the most important rooms in a home and can have a big impact on the value of your home. Consider updating countertops, cabinets, and appliances in the kitchen and updating the fixtures, tile and countertops in the bathrooms.

  4. Flooring:

    If your flooring is in poor condition, it can be a major turn-off to potential buyers. Consider replacing old carpet, refinishing hardwood floors, or adding new tile.

  5. De-clutter and stage your home:

    Before you list your home, it’s important to declutter and stage it. This can help potential buyers envision themselves living in the home and make it easier for them to see the potential of the space.

By making these updates to your home, you can increase its value and appeal to potential buyers. It's important to keep in mind that some updates may be more important than others depending on the condition of your home.
